Mental health strategy for the energy sector released

by Energy Journalist
October 13, 2017
in Networks, News, Safety and Training, Spotlight
Reading Time: 2 mins read
A A
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Energy Networks Australia (ENA) has released a mental health and wellbeing strategy for the energy sector as part of the national energy Mental Health and Wellbeing forum in Melbourne.

Energy Networks Australian Interim CEO, Andrew Dillon, said the rapid transformation of the energy sector has created well-recognised opportunities and challenges for the industry.

“The energy industry is experiencing exciting change that is important for our community but it can also create an uncertain environment for the sector’s workforce,” Mr Dillon said.

“The unique nature of energy networks, responding to natural disasters and emergencies, working in rural or remote areas, calls for a whole of industry commitment to mental health and wellbeing.

“This week Australians recognise National Mental Health week in order to raise public awareness and reduce stigma around mental health issues.

“The Energy Networks Australia Mental Health and Wellbeing Strategy has been developed to better position the energy sector to create a positive mental health and wellbeing environment for our workforce and community.”

Mr Dillon said the ENA has a vision that prioritises the need to establish appropriate mental health and wellbeing practices across the industry.

“Building on the work network businesses have already undertaken, this strategy provides clear direction and tools for our members, demonstrating our commitment to the mental health and wellbeing of our workforce as part of maintaining a safe workplace,” Mr Dillon said.
